AY53 LKP is a 2003 Toyota Previa in Green with a 2,362c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 31 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 67.7%.
Across all 2003 Toyota Previa models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.8% with a typical mileage of 102,422 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ota Previa f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 25,856 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AY53 LKP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Previa typ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 23 years old, this Toyota Previa is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
